How to become a citizen of the Republic of Armenia
The procedure for acquisition of citizenship of the Republic of Armenia has undergone certain changes since the adoption of the law on dual citizenship in Armenia.
Before, applicants were required to have knowledge of the RA Constitution, a medical document, a certificate verifying that the applicant had not been sentenced and more.
Today, those who can speak in Armenian, are of Armenian origin and have Armenian ancestors can apply for RA citizenship.
Applicants must submit the following documents:
-Appeal to the RA President
-CV (in the form of the embassy)
-Birth certificate and passport with copies
-Six 35x45mm photos
-Document verifying Armenian origin (baptism document)
The applicant will receive a passport of the Republic of Armenia after the appeal is ratified (within a year). Before, passports were granted within 30 days. Now, there is a limited time, meaning that the applicant decides when he or she receives the passport after the appeal is ratified.
The legal division of the RA Ministry of Diaspora informed tert.am that in 2011, 14,276 Armenians had applied for RA citizenship and most of the applicants were from Georgia (7,021 citizens), followed by Syria (2,983), Lebanon (2,014), Russia (965) and Iran (489).
